A profitable program at Bethel Church

110 YEARS AGO

Thursday, May 30, 1907

from the Mathews Journal

Quite a crowd gathered at Bethel Church on Sunday night last to witness one of the most illustrious melodramatics that has ever taken place there. In the program were recitations by Charlie and Christine Hudgins, Jessie Campbell, Evelyne Lilly, Harvey Brooks and Leonard Morse, and duets by Mary S. and Andie Minter and Sarah Thomas and Eunice Hudgins. One of the most liberal collections that has ever been taken around here was received, and in it was a five dollar gold piece, given by a friend for promptitude of exercises. We thank him very much. Hope it was interesting to all.
